Here are five things to do in Newton this weekend,

Friday, Feb. 9

  • From 3 to 5 p.m., the Jewish Community Center of Greater Boston will host Beginner Bridge, a class to learn to play the famous card game, taught by bridge teacher Jori Grossack, known as “The Bridge Whisperer.”

Saturday, Feb. 10

  • At noon, The Biltmore will have its first Drag Brunch of the year, Head Over Heels. Make sure to remember to bring dollar bills.
  • From 1 to 2:30 p.m., the Scandinavian Living Center will stream the film “Fallen Leaves.”

Sunday, Feb. 11

From 12 to 4 p.m., the New Art Center will host “Year of the Dragon: Lunar New Year Celebration.” with performances and art activities for the whole family to enjoy.

At 2 p.m., First Unitarian Universalist Society of Newton will host “FUUSN Musicians Concert,” in support of the church’s Urban Ministry efforts.
